The Friendly Butcher isn't just a name, it's a fact. Everybody in there is smiling, friendly and banters with customers.
As Andrew A. says, the sandwiches are built around outstanding meat. The steak sandwich is a steak, cooked up after you place your order. No lousy strips of pre-cooked steak here! Turkey and roast beef are shaved fresh and deliciously juicy. Your sandwich is built on your choice of several breads or buns, including a multigrain that -- unlike some that I choke down to feel virtuous -- actually tastes great.
Toppings are pretty standard, and even with my minimalist approach (cheese and BBQ sauce) you've still got a filling lunch.
My one complaint is that on Saturday they may be out of some bread types and toppings. I can't bring myself to downrate a star for it, though, since whatever you opt for as your second choice is still awesome. (But feel free to skip hot peppers so there's some left for me.)
